Bucharest resident files complaint for assault by cab driver over paying only the metered price

26 March 2017

A Bucharest resident filed a complaint with the police claiming he had been beaten by a cab driver for refusing to pay more than the metered sum, Digi24 reported. The incident took place on February 11 but the attacker has not been identified yet.

The man who filed the complained took the cab from the Old Town of the capital. He said the cab driver asked him for RON 25 for the ride and he went into the cab without saying if he accepted or not this fee. When the cab reached the destination, the metered fee was of around RON 10, the man says. He paid RON 11, and asked for a receipt but the driver refused to give it to him. After getting out of the car, he saw the driver coming after him with a baseball bat. The man ended up at the hospital with a 5 centimeters wound to the head and other injuries, Digi24 reported.

The assaulted man says the driver was working for the Leone cab company but the cab company says the car number provided by the victim of the assault was never registered with them. At the same time, Leone said it was cooperating with the authorities.

The investigation in the case is still ongoing.
